Meaning:
Ultrasonic pediatric nebulizers are medical devices used to convert liquid medication into a fine mist or aerosol for inhalation therapy in pediatric patients with respiratory conditions. Unlike traditional compressor-based nebulizers, ultrasonic nebulizers utilize high-frequency vibrations to generate aerosol particles, resulting in faster and quieter drug delivery. These devices are designed to meet the unique needs of pediatric patients, providing gentle and effective respiratory therapy with minimal discomfort.

Category-wise Insight:
Ultrasonic Pediatric Nebulizers offer targeted respiratory therapy solutions for various pediatric respiratory conditions, including:
- Asthma Management: Ultrasonic Pediatric Nebulizers are widely used for asthma management in pediatric patients, delivering bronchodilators, corticosteroids, and other medications to relieve symptoms, prevent exacerbations, and improve lung function.
- Bronchitis Treatment: Nebulized medications such as bronchodilators, mucolytics, and antibiotics are commonly administered via Ultrasonic Pediatric Nebulizers for the treatment of bronchitis and other respiratory infections in children.
- Cystic Fibrosis Therapy: Ultrasonic Pediatric Nebulizers play a crucial role in cystic fibrosis therapy, delivering hypertonic saline, mucolytics, antibiotics, and other medications to help clear airway secretions, reduce inflammation, and prevent respiratory complications in pediatric patients with cystic fibrosis.
- Other Pediatric Respiratory Conditions: Ultrasonic Pediatric Nebulizers may also be used in the management of other pediatric respiratory conditions such as pneumonia, bronchiolitis, and obstructive sleep apnea, providing targeted medication delivery and symptom relief as part of comprehensive respiratory care.
